Algebraic properties of the Einstein--Cartan action
Zapiski Nauchnykh Seminarov POMI, Questions of quantum field theory and statistical physics. Part 22, Tome 398 (2012), pp. 55-63
Voir la notice de l'article provenant de la source Math-Net.Ru
Algebraic properties of the matrix operators which act on the torsion in the Einstein–Cartan action are studied. Multiplication rules are written and corresponding equations of motion are explored in different variables.
